Product overview
Human IL-8 ELISA Kit (ab214030) is a single-wash 90 min sandwich ELISA designed for the quantitative measurement of IL-8 protein in cit plasma, edta plasma, hep plasma, serum, and cell culture supernatant. It uses our proprietary SimpleStep ELISA® technology. Quantitate Human IL-8 with 1.8 pg/ml sensitivity.
SimpleStep ELISA® technology employs capture antibodies conjugated to an affinity tag that is recognized by the monoclonal antibody used to coat our SimpleStep ELISA® plates. This approach to sandwich ELISA allows the formation of the antibody-analyte sandwich complex in a single step, significantly reducing assay time. ASSAY SPECIFICITY
This kit recognizes both native and recombinant human IL-8 protein in serum, plasma, and cell culture supernatant samples only.
Cell and tissue extract samples have not been tested with this kit.
SPECIES REACTIVITY
This kit recognizes human IL-8 protein.
Other species reactivity was determined by measuring 100% mouse, rat, and bovine serum samples, interpolating the IL-8 protein concentrations from the human standard curve, and expressing the interpolated concentrations as a percentage of the IL-8 protein concentration in human serum assayed at the same dilution.
Reactivity < 3% was determined for the following species: Mouse, Rat, Cow
CALIBRATION
This immunoassay is calibrated against a highly purified human IL-8. The NIBSC/WHO unclassified purified human IL-8 preparation 89/520 was evaluated in this kit.
The dose response curve of the unclassified standard IL-8 parallels the SimpleStep standard curve. To convert sample values obtained with the SimpleStep Human IL-8 kit to approximate NIBSC IU/mL units, use the equation below.
NIBSC (89/250) approximate value (IU/mL) = 0.0042 x SimpleStep Human IL-8 value (pg/mL).

Function
IL-8 is a chemotactic factor that attracts neutrophils, basophils, and T-cells, but not monocytes. It is also involved in neutrophil activation. It is released from several cell types in response to an inflammatory stimulus. IL-8(6-77) has a 5-10-fold higher activity on neutrophil activation, IL-8(5-77) has increased activity on neutrophil activation and IL-8(7-77) has a higher affinity to receptors CXCR1 and CXCR2 as compared to IL-8(1-77), respectively. -
Sequence similarities
Belongs to the intercrine alpha (chemokine CxC) family. -
Post-translational
modificationsSeveral N-terminal processed forms are produced by proteolytic cleavage after secretion from at least peripheral blood monocytes, leukcocytes and endothelial cells. In general, IL-8(1-77) is referred to as interleukin-8. IL-8(6-77) is the most promiment form. -
